.author-bio.svelte-w433pw{display:flex;align-items:flex-start;gap:1rem;padding:1.25rem;margin:2rem 0;background-color:#1a1a2e;background-color:var(--void-surface, #1a1a2e);border:1px solid rgba(124,58,237,.2);border-radius:12px;max-width:48rem}.author-bio.compact.svelte-w433pw{padding:1rem;margin:1.5rem 0}.author-bio.compact.svelte-w433pw .author-photo:where(.svelte-w433pw){width:48px;height:48px}.author-bio.compact.svelte-w433pw .author-name:where(.svelte-w433pw){font-size:.9375rem}.author-bio.compact.svelte-w433pw .author-role:where(.svelte-w433pw){font-size:.75rem}.author-photo-link.svelte-w433pw{flex-shrink:0;text-decoration:none;border-radius:50%;transition:opacity .2s ease}.author-photo-link.svelte-w433pw:hover{opacity:.85}.author-photo-link.svelte-w433pw:after{content:none!important;display:none!important}.author-photo.svelte-w433pw{width:72px;height:72px;border-radius:50%;-o-object-fit:cover;object-fit:cover;border:2px solid rgba(124,58,237,.4)}.author-info.svelte-w433pw{flex:1;min-width:0}.author-name-row.svelte-w433pw{display:flex;align-items:baseline;gap:.5rem;flex-wrap:wrap;margin-bottom:.25rem}.author-name.svelte-w433pw{margin:0;font-size:1.0625rem;font-weight:700;line-height:1.3}.author-name.svelte-w433pw a:where(.svelte-w433pw){color:#f1f5f9;text-decoration:none;transition:color .2s ease}.author-name.svelte-w433pw a:where(.svelte-w433pw):hover{color:#c4b5fd;color:var(--shadow-monarch-lightest, #c4b5fd)}.author-name.svelte-w433pw a:where(.svelte-w433pw):after{content:none!important;display:none!important}.author-role.svelte-w433pw{font-size:.8125rem;color:#94a3b8;white-space:nowrap}.author-bio-text.svelte-w433pw{margin:.375rem 0 .5rem;font-size:.875rem;line-height:1.55;color:#cbd5e1}.author-links.svelte-w433pw{display:flex;gap:.5rem;margin-top:.25rem}.social-link.svelte-w433pw{display:flex;align-items:center;justify-content:center;width:32px;height:32px;border-radius:8px;color:#94a3b8;background:#64748b1a;transition:all .2s ease;text-decoration:none}.social-link.svelte-w433pw:hover{color:#f1f5f9;background:#7c3aed33}.social-link.svelte-w433pw:after{content:none!important;display:none!important}@media(max-width:500px){.author-bio.svelte-w433pw{gap:.75rem;padding:1rem}.author-bio.compact.svelte-w433pw .author-photo:where(.svelte-w433pw){width:40px;height:40px}.author-photo.svelte-w433pw{width:56px;height:56px}.author-name.svelte-w433pw{font-size:.9375rem}.author-bio-text.svelte-w433pw{font-size:.8125rem}.social-link.svelte-w433pw{width:28px;height:28px}.social-link.svelte-w433pw svg:where(.svelte-w433pw){width:15px;height:15px}}
